How far is it from Green Bay to Chicago?

The great-circle distance between Austin Straubel International Airport (GRB) and Chicago O'Hare International Airport (ORD) is 279 km (173 mi, 151 nautical miles). That is the straight-line distance; a real flight is a little longer because of air-traffic routing.

How long is the flight from GRB to ORD?

A nonstop flight typically takes about 50m. This is an estimate from the distance; actual block times depend on the aircraft, winds and the exact routing. ORD is roughly south of GRB.

How is the GRB to ORD route written in code?

The pair is written GRB-ORD in IATA codes and KGRB-KORD in ICAO codes, the form used on a flight plan. Austin Straubel International Airport is GRB (KGRB), Chicago O'Hare International Airport is ORD (KORD).

Both ICAO codes start with K, the prefix ICAO assigns to the contiguous United States, so this is a route inside one ICAO region. How ICAO prefixes are laid out.

The two fields sit at almost the same height, within 15 ft (5 m) of each other.
